DeepSeek management has told potential investors during an ongoing RMB70 billion fundraising round that the company will prioritize breakthrough in AI research over short-term commercialization, Bloomberg reported, citing people with the knowledge of the matter. The company is in the final stages of discussions for the financing deal, sources divulged. Prior to this round, DeepSeek was valued at approximately USD45 billion.
